Disk encryption security on Windows centers on BitLocker, Microsoft's full-disk encryption tool designed to protect data when a device is lost or stolen. Recent discussions highlight CVE-2026-45658, a BitLocker security feature bypass addressed in the June 9, 2026 Patch Tuesday update. This vulnerability allows an attacker with physical access to bypass BitLocker's protection, underscoring that disk encryption is not infallible. The flaw is rated Important and is not remotely exploitable, but it raises concerns about recovery mechanisms and disclosure practices. For IT professionals and security-conscious users, understanding these risks is essential for assessing the real-world security of encrypted drives.
